Description

Mockingbird is a powerful novel of a future world where humans are dying. Those who survive spend their days in narcotic bliss or choose quick suicide rather than face slow extinction. Humanity's salvation rests with an android who has no desire to live, and with a man and a woman who must discover love, hope, and dreams of a world reborn.
